The story of Florence Kate Luckie Ring began in 1860 in St. John, Saint John, New Brunswick, Canada.. Florence Kate Luckie Ring married Alexander Duncan Woodruff, and had children including Alexander Duncan Luckie, Alice Duncan Luckie, Claude Woodruff Duncan Luckie, Hubert St Clair Duncan Luckie, Leonard Fenton Duncan Luckie, Reginald Duncan Luckie. Florence Kate Luckie Ring passed away in 1907 in Crail, Fife, Scotland.
